The invention belongs to the technical field of
chemical synthesis of medicines, and particularly relates to a preparation method of
avibactam sodium. According to the method, (2S, 5R)-trans-5-hydroxypiperidine-2-
formic acid is taken as a starting
raw material, hydroxyl in the (2S, 5R)-trans-5-hydroxypiperidine-2-
formic acid is efficiently and selectively converted into hydroximido by adopting an electrochemical method, the condition is mild, the method is environment-friendly, and the
pollution problem caused by using an equivalent
metal reducing agent or an
oxidizing agent in a traditional chemical method is avoided; after O-benzyl
oxime ether is constructed, a (2S, 5R)
absolute configuration required by
avibactam sodium is constructed and maintained through stereoselective reduction and efficient
amination. From (2S, 5R)-trans-5-hydroxypiperidine-2-
formic acid to
avibactam sodium, the
route design is ingenious, the steps are shorter, and a novel, simple and efficient synthesis
route is provided for synthesis of
avibactam sodium.
